Transaction 62dede8cd8d147ab4473db72e54659e3aab44b34cca48b12af3c18ca923d7039

1 Input
2 Outputs
  • 62dede8cd8d147ab4473db72e54659e3aab44b34cca48b12af3c18ca923d7039:0
  • value  2905786704
    address  3EC5guWUak4etFk5BiKrGgLP7tV1H7xh5z
  • 62dede8cd8d147ab4473db72e54659e3aab44b34cca48b12af3c18ca923d7039:1
  • value  3500000
    address  1M8KgqkBPmeXJVmXjjj1AswH5upnmqFZmj